Abstract
Systems and methods for removing hydrogen peroxide from water purification systems are provided. In a general embodiment, the present disclosure provides a water purification system including a water treatment unit, an electrodeionization unit and a hydrogen peroxide decomposition catalyst in fluid connection with the electrodeionization unit. The water purification system can be fluidly connected to a renal treatment system.

14. A method of purifying water, the method comprising:
-
passing water through a water treatment unit; passing the water through an electrodeionization unit to produce a rejected water stream; passing the rejected water stream through a hydrogen peroxide decomposition catalyst; and recirculating the rejected water stream back through the water treatment unit. - View Dependent Claims (15, 16, 17)

18. A method of disinfecting a water purification system, the method comprising:
-
passing water through a circuit of the water purification system; adding hydrogen peroxide to the water to circulate through the circuit; and passing the water having the hydrogen peroxide through a unit having a hydrogen peroxide decomposition catalyst.

19. A method of performing dialysis, the method comprising:
-
passing water through a water treatment unit; passing the water through an electrodeionization unit, the electrodeionization unit producing a rejected water stream and a purified water stream; passing the purified water stream to a dialysis treatment system; and recirculating the rejected water stream through a hydrogen peroxide decomposition catalyst and back to the water treatment unit. - View Dependent Claims (20, 21)

22. A method of preventing the formation of bacterial contamination in a water purification system during dialysis, the method comprising:
-
passing water through a circuit of a water treatment unit; adding hydrogen peroxide to a fluid stream of the water treatment unit; circulating the fluid stream through a hydrogen peroxide decomposition catalyst; and passing the fluid stream to a renal treatment system.
